Situated in the beautiful East Neuk of Fife, with panoramic views over the Firth of Forth, Selkirk Lodge is one of the five newly built lodges situated within Homelands, a charitable trust providing accessible self-catering accommodation. The lodge has been purpose built for people with disabilities, long term health conditions and life limiting illnesses, consequently a wealth of features have been incorporated into the designs to ensure they are accessible.

Selkirk Lodge has free Superfast Wi-Fi with sleeping up to six people. Offering open plan living with a spacious kitchen, dining, and living area. Finished to a high standard and the perfect place to come and relax. Patio doors open off the living area onto the garden. On the ground floor you will find a twin bedroom which has an Invacare Medley Ergo electric profiling bed with Invacare Softform Premier Active 2 airflow mattress plus Guldmann H-frame ceiling tracking hoist, a utility room, a wet room featuring showering area with Guldmann H-frame ceiling tracking hoist plus a separate toilet with wash hand basin are also housed on the ground floor. In addition to the fixed equipment there are a wide range of portable specialist equipment available free of charge, but must be booked as soon as possible prior to arrival. Please contact Homelands to add specialist equipment to your stay so that availability can be confirmed, including a shower trolley, portable hoist, Freeway shower chair/commode (assisted/unassisted), Oxford electric stand aid and assisted or manual wheelchairs.

On the first floor where you will find two bedrooms, the spacious main room set as a double/twin bedroom and the second naturally set as a twin room. The first floor bathroom features a bath where you can lie back and relax while enjoying a well earned rest and a separate shower cubicle. Outside there is a lovely lawned garden with patio and garden furniture.

The East Neuk of Fife is the home of golf, and features beautiful rolling countryside complimented by a rugged coastline and picturesque fishing villages. Fife is famed for its fresh produce particularly seafood and they are proud to boast 3, 1 star Michelin restaurants in the East Neuk as well as numerous other fantastic dining experiences including award-winning fish and chips. Lundin Links itself is a small friendly village which features a bar/restaurant, a small parade of shops and various sporting activities, including sea fishing (licence required), all within a short walk from Homelands. We do not provide slings for any of the hoists we provide, therefore clients must bring their own (our hoists require looped slings). In addition we do not provide training on use of our hoists therefore ask that anyone wishing to use the hoists is familiar with them on their operation.
